#420ae8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#420ae8 is composed of 25.9% red, 3.9%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.6% cyan, 95.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 255.1 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 47.5%. #420ae8 color hex could be obtained by blending #8414ff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#420ae8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#420ae8 has RGB values of R:66, G:10,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 4328168.

Shades and Tints of #420ae8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020006 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#420ae8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757082 is the less saturated color, while #3d01f1 is the most saturated one.
